LabradoriteLabradorite beads and pendants offer striking rainbow-colored reflections when light hits them from a particular direction. The labradorescence, or schiller, in these semiprecious beads and pendants offers the same stunning visual effect created by gasoline on water, or light on the delicate wings of tropical butterflies. Also known as black moonstone, falcon's eye, and labordite, this semiprecious gemstone is a sodium-rich variety of plagioclase feldspar found in igneous or metamorphic rocks. It is in the same gemstone family as moonstone and spectrolite (a high-quality labradorite mined in Finland). Labradorite is believed to detoxify the body, slow the aging process, elevate consciousness, and protect a person's aura. Lapis lazuli is a semi-precious stone that contains primarily lazurite, calcite and pyrite. It was among the first gemstones to be worn as jewelry. Azure Agate: Our azure agate beads are darker blue than many azure agate beads on the market. They are a vivid mix of indigo, cobalt blue, white, black, translucent gray and occasionally some red-browns. Some of the beads have dark blue or black spots like evil eye beads. Like other Fired Agate, the rich blues in these semi-precious beads are achieved via a combination of heat and dyes. The color goes great with new blue jeans, and is an economical alternative to lapis lazuli.
